logo

Output 69ea17060712b585a8dacd20bf17598a448d5dccf39c958ca14972be35144606:0

value
284570
script pubkey
OP_HASH160 OP_PUSHBYTES_20 763d6dac8206eb85c0d4afc720da91967277a4a4 OP_EQUAL
address
3CUDFJPwWSQ9PL1iQwRTGFhhFUUXCQXJEe
transaction
69ea17060712b585a8dacd20bf17598a448d5dccf39c958ca14972be35144606